the Emergence of 'Extremism': Exposing Violent Discourse and Language 'Radicalisation'
Pages: 256, Paperback, Bloomsbury Academic
Price History
Prices were last updated on:
Pages: 256, Paperback, Bloomsbury Academic
Prices were last updated on: